Series B 12% Convertible Preferred Stock Purchase Agreement between Integrated Information Systems, Inc. and Purchasers

Summary

Integrated Information Systems, Inc. is entering into an agreement with certain purchasers to sell up to 200,000 shares of its Series B 12% Convertible Preferred Stock at $10.00 per share. The agreement outlines the terms for the purchase, including conversion rights into common stock, conditions for closing, and representations by the company regarding its authority and the validity of the shares. The agreement also includes an exchange of Series A Preferred Stock for Series B shares. The closing is subject to certain filings and the execution of a registration rights agreement.

EX-10.59 18 ex10-59.txt Exhibit 10.59 SERIES B 12% CONVERTIBLE PREFERRED STOCK PURCHASE AGREEMENT THIS SECURITIES PURCHASE AGREEMENT (this "Agreement"), is made and entered into by and among Integrated Information Systems, Inc., a Delaware corporation (the "Company"), and the purchasers named on the attached Schedule A, as the same may be supplemented from time to time (collectively the "Purchasers" and each individually a "Purchaser"). With respect to the initial purchase and sale of Shares hereunder, the effective date of this Agreement shall be April 4, 2003. RECITALS A. The Company wishes to issue and sell to one or more Purchasers up to 200,000 shares (the "Shares") of Series B 12% Convertible Preferred Stock par value $0.001 per share (the "Preferred Stock"), at a per share purchase price of $10.00. B. Each Purchaser wishes to purchase the Shares on the terms and subject to the conditions set forth in this Agreement. AGREEMENT N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the premises and the mutual covenants contained in this Agreement and for other good and valuable consideration, the receipt and sufficiency of which are hereby acknowledged, and intending to be legally bound, the parties agree as follows: 1. Sale of Shares. a. Issuance, Sale and Delivery of the Shares. Subject to the terms and conditions hereof and in reliance upon the representations, warranties, covenants and agreements contained herein, the Corporation hereby agrees to issue and sell to the Purchasers, and each Purchaser hereby severally agrees to purchase from the Corporation at a Closing (as hereinafter defined), the aggregate number of Shares set forth opposite the name of such Purchaser under the heading "Number of Preferred Shares" on Schedule A attached hereto. Each Purchaser's Shares will be convertible into shares of the Company's $0.001 par value common stock (the "Common Stock") as set forth in the Certificate of Designation (as hereinafter defined). b. Closing. Each sale and purchase of any Shares shall take place at a closing (each, a "Closing") at the Company's offices in Tempe, Arizona at such date and time as may be mutually agreed upon by the Company and the Purchasers, with the first Closing to take place on April 4, 2003 at 10:00 a.m.; provided, however, that the obligations of the Purchasers hereunder are subject to: (i) The Corporation's filing of a Certificate of Designation with respect to the Preferred Stock in form and substance reasonably satisfactory to the Purchasers (the "Certificate of Designation"); and (ii) The Corporation shall have executed and delivered to the Purchasers a Registration Rights Agreement, in form and substance reasonably satisfactory to the Purchasers (the "Registration Rights Agreement"). c. Deliveries at Closing. Upon a purchase of Shares at a Closing, the Corporation shall issue and deliver to each Purchaser a stock certificate evidencing the Shares purchased at the Closing. As payment in full for the Shares being purchased by it at the Closing, and against delivery of the certificates for the Shares, each Purchaser shall deliver to the Corporation, by official check or wire transfer, the "Aggregate Subscription Price" amount set forth opposite the Purchaser's name on Schedule A. In addition to the initial purchase of Shares hereunder, the Corporation and the purchaser identified on Schedule A have agreed, at the Closing for such initial purchase and in consideration for such purchaser agreeing to purchase Shares hereunder, to exchange 40,000 shares of the Corporation's Series A 8% Convertible Preferred Stock for 40,000 Shares of the Preferred Stock. 2. Covenants. a. Reservation of Conversion Shares. The Corporation shall at all times reserve and keep available out of its authorized but unissued shares of Common Stock, for the purpose of effecting the conversion of the Shares, such number of its duly authorized shares of Common Stock as shall be sufficient to effect the conversion of the Shares from time to time outstanding. If at any time the number of authorized but unissued shares of Common Stock shall not be sufficient to effect the conversion of the Shares, the Corporation will forthwith take such corporate action as may be necessary to increase its authorized but unissued shares of Common Stock to such number of shares as shall be sufficient for such purposes. The Corporation will use reasonable efforts to obtain any authorization, consent, approval or other action by or make any filing with any court or administrative body that may be required under applicable state securities laws in connection with the issuance of shares of Common Stock upon conversion of the Shares. Without limiting the generality of the foregoing, in the event that the number of Conversion Shares issuable upon conversion of the Preferred Stock would exceed 19.99% of the Common Stock issued and outstanding at the date of the first sale of Preferred Stock, a majority in interest of the Purchasers may request, by delivering written notice to the Corporation, that the Corporation call a special meeting of its stockholders to approve the Corporation's issuance of the full number of Conversion Shares in order that such issuance will comply with Marketplace Rule 4350(i) of The Nasdaq Stock Market. Upon receipt of such request, the Corporation agrees to promptly call such special meeting of its stockholders, and in connection therewith, to promptly file a preliminary proxy statement with the Securities and Exchange Commission and otherwise use all reasonable commercial efforts to obtain such stockholder approval; provided, however, that the Purchasers shall not be entitled to deliver a call for such a meeting for a period of one year after the initial sale of Shares under this Agreement and that previously issued Conversion Shares shall not be eligible to vote on the proposal. b. Registration Rights. The Corporation and the Purchasers shall promptly negotiate in good faith, execute and deliver a registration rights agreement in order to provide the Purchasers with "piggyback" registration rights with respect to the sale of the Conversion Shares in two registrations, with the Corporation paying the costs of the Purchasers for such registrations. c.
